A .rar file is a data container used to compress large amounts of data into a single, easily downloadable file. In the context of music archiving, enthusiasts often bundle full-album audio tracks (such as MP3 or FLAC files) along with high-resolution digital booklet scans into a RAR archive to preserve the album artwork and liner notes exactly as they appeared in the original 2002 physical release.
